Method for identification of tokens in video sequences
First Claim
1. A method for automatically identifying tokens associated with an event in video sequences containing individual takes and extracting information contained thereon including the steps of:
- classifying the candidate regions into token or non-token, locating tokens in candidate regions, locating information on the token, interpreting the information on the token, performing a confidence analysis on the information to ensure that the information was interpreted correctly, wherein the method further includes the steps of;
detecting boundaries between individual takes, pre-selecting candidate regions in images of the video sequence following or preceding a detected boundary prior to the step of classifying the candidate regions, and that the method also further includes the steps of merging information of consecutive images into a single, coherent set of information, and detecting changes in the visual appearance of the token, the changes signalling a particular point of an event, after the step of performing the confidence analysis.

Abstract
For identification of tokens in video sequences, first the sequence is scanned for boundaries between consecutive parts of the sequence, where appearance of the tokens is expected. After that, candidate regions are pre-selected and classified in parts of the video sequence adjacent to detected boundaries and tokens are located in the candidate regions. Information carried on the tokens is located, interpreted and merged into consistent sets of information after passing a confidence analysis. In parallel, changes in the visual appearance of the token signaling a special event are detected.
